fields is now a priority for the sake of diversity. She added that "of course all studies show that when a profession becomes 'pink-collared,' whether you wear a pink collar or not, salaries go down." Feldman made these assertions despite a 2014 report by the
Association of Art Museum Directors (AAMD) and the National Center for Arts Research (NCAR) which "found that a gender gap existed in art museum directorships... that women held less than half of directorships, that the average female director's salary lagged behind that of the average male director, and that these phenomena were most persistent in the largest museums." A second report in 2017 found that, "despite press attention and field-wide dialogue on the topic, the gender gap persists."
213:. During her tenure, she expanded the collection and attendance doubled. Digital access was emphasized, and social justice and equity programs were adopted. Upon being selected by the National Gallery, she resigned her offices at the Minneapolis Institute with her last day set on March 1, 2019, and assumed her new position in Washington ten days later. She is the NGA's first woman director.
